Executive Summary
Selecting an ERP for a subscription business is not the same as selecting ERP for a traditional product manufacturer or project-led services firm. The decision must support recurring billing, contract amendments, usage-based pricing, deferred revenue, multi-entity consolidation, tax complexity, and global operating scale without creating finance bottlenecks or engineering workarounds. For CIOs, CTOs, enterprise architects, and ERP partners, the core question is not which ERP is most popular. It is which operating model best aligns with revenue complexity, governance requirements, integration strategy, and long-term cost structure.
In practice, most enterprise evaluations come down to four patterns: finance-first SaaS ERP suites, platform-centric ERP with strong extensibility, self-hosted or private cloud ERP for control-heavy environments, and partner-led white-label ERP models for firms building repeatable industry solutions. Each model has strengths and trade-offs across implementation complexity, compliance readiness, customization, operational resilience, and total cost of ownership. The right choice depends on whether the business prioritizes speed to standardization, deep process control, OEM opportunities, or managed operational accountability.
What should executives compare first in a subscription ERP evaluation?
Executive teams often start with feature lists, but subscription ERP selection should begin with operating risk. Revenue recognition accuracy, billing flexibility, integration reliability, and global entity governance usually have greater financial impact than broad module counts. A sound evaluation methodology starts by mapping the revenue lifecycle from quote and contract through invoicing, collections, recognition, reporting, renewals, and audit support. This reveals where the ERP must be system-of-record, where adjacent SaaS platforms can remain specialized, and where integration failure would create material business exposure.
| Evaluation Dimension | Why It Matters for Subscription Businesses | What to Test During Selection |
|---|---|---|
| Revenue recognition | Recurring contracts, amendments, bundles, and usage pricing increase accounting complexity | Contract modification handling, deferred revenue schedules, audit traceability, ASC 606 and IFRS 15 support |
| Subscription operations | Billing errors directly affect cash flow, retention, and customer trust | Recurring billing, proration, renewals, usage events, credit memos, and collections workflows |
| Global scale | Multi-entity growth introduces tax, currency, localization, and consolidation demands | Multi-currency, intercompany, local compliance support, entity-level controls, and consolidated reporting |
| Integration architecture | CRM, CPQ, payment, product, and data platforms must stay synchronized | API-first architecture, event handling, middleware fit, data model consistency, and failure recovery |
| Governance and security | Finance and platform teams need control without slowing operations | Identity and access management, segregation of duties, audit logs, approval workflows, and policy enforcement |
| TCO and operating model | Licensing and cloud choices shape long-term economics more than initial implementation alone | Per-user vs unlimited-user licensing, managed services needs, customization cost, and cloud deployment model |
How do the main ERP operating models compare?
For subscription-led enterprises, ERP decisions are increasingly about operating model fit rather than software category labels. A finance-first SaaS ERP can accelerate standardization and reduce infrastructure burden, but may constrain deep process tailoring. A platform-centric ERP can support more extensibility and partner-led solution design, but requires stronger governance and architecture discipline. Self-hosted, private cloud, or hybrid cloud models can improve control and data residency alignment, yet they shift more operational accountability to the customer or service partner.
| ERP Model | Best Fit | Primary Advantages | Key Trade-offs |
|---|---|---|---|
| Multi-tenant SaaS ERP | Organizations prioritizing speed, standardization, and lower infrastructure management | Faster upgrades, lower platform operations burden, predictable service model, easier global rollout for standard processes | Less control over stack behavior, possible limits on deep customization, vendor roadmap dependency, shared-tenancy constraints |
| Dedicated cloud ERP | Enterprises needing stronger isolation, performance control, or tailored governance | More operational flexibility, stronger environment control, easier accommodation of specialized integrations and security policies | Higher cost than multi-tenant SaaS, more deployment design decisions, greater need for cloud operations discipline |
| Private cloud or self-hosted ERP | Regulated, control-heavy, or highly customized environments | Maximum control over deployment, data handling, upgrade timing, and infrastructure architecture | Higher operational overhead, slower modernization if governance is weak, larger internal or partner dependency |
| Hybrid cloud ERP | Businesses balancing legacy dependencies with modernization goals | Pragmatic migration path, selective retention of critical systems, reduced disruption during transition | Integration complexity, duplicated controls, data consistency risk, and potentially higher long-term TCO |
| White-label ERP platform model | Partners, MSPs, and integrators building repeatable industry offerings or OEM opportunities | Brand control, service-led differentiation, packaging flexibility, and stronger partner ecosystem alignment | Requires clear support model, governance standards, and disciplined solution ownership across partner and platform provider |
Where do subscription operations and revenue recognition create the biggest ERP gaps?
The largest ERP failures in SaaS businesses usually appear at the intersection of commercial flexibility and financial control. Sales teams want rapid packaging changes, finance needs recognition accuracy, and operations needs billing reliability. If the ERP cannot model contract changes cleanly, organizations often compensate with spreadsheets, custom scripts, or disconnected billing tools. That may work temporarily, but it weakens auditability, slows close cycles, and increases revenue leakage risk.
Executives should test real scenarios rather than generic demos: mid-term upgrades, downgrades, co-termed renewals, bundled services, prepaid credits, usage overages, regional tax differences, and multi-entity transfers. The goal is to understand whether the ERP supports these patterns natively, through configuration, through extensibility, or only through custom development. That distinction materially affects implementation risk, TCO, and future agility.
Best-practice evaluation criteria for finance and platform teams
- Validate the full contract-to-cash and revenue-to-report lifecycle using your own pricing and amendment scenarios.
- Separate must-have accounting controls from desirable commercial flexibility to avoid overengineering the platform.
- Assess whether workflow automation reduces manual approvals, exception handling, and close-cycle effort.
- Confirm business intelligence and reporting can support board, audit, and operational management needs without excessive data duplication.
- Review scalability under transaction growth, entity expansion, and increased API traffic, not just user counts.
- Test identity and access management, segregation of duties, and role design early because governance retrofits are expensive.
How should leaders think about licensing models, TCO, and ROI?
Licensing models can materially change ERP economics over a three- to seven-year horizon. Per-user licensing may appear efficient at first, but can become restrictive as finance, operations, support, regional teams, and external stakeholders need broader access. Unlimited-user licensing can improve adoption and process visibility, especially in distributed operating models, but only if the platform and governance model support broad participation without creating control issues. The right choice depends on workforce scale, partner access requirements, and the degree to which ERP workflows extend beyond finance.
TCO should include more than subscription fees or infrastructure cost. Executives should model implementation services, integration middleware, customization maintenance, testing, upgrade effort, managed cloud services, security operations, reporting architecture, and internal support overhead. ROI often comes from fewer billing errors, faster close, reduced manual reconciliations, improved renewal execution, and better decision quality through unified data. Those benefits are real, but they only materialize when process design, governance, and adoption are addressed together.
| Cost or Value Driver | Multi-tenant SaaS ERP | Dedicated or Private Cloud ERP | Business Implication |
|---|---|---|---|
| Infrastructure operations | Usually lower direct burden | Higher responsibility unless outsourced | Managed cloud services can narrow the operational gap |
| Customization maintenance | Often constrained but simpler if kept light | More flexible but can grow costly over time | Extensibility discipline matters more than customization volume |
| Upgrade effort | Typically more standardized | More controllable but potentially heavier | Control can reduce disruption but may increase internal workload |
| User access economics | Depends on vendor licensing model | Depends on platform and commercial structure | Unlimited-user models may improve adoption in broad operating environments |
| Compliance and governance effort | Shared controls may simplify some areas | Customer-specific controls may be stronger | The right model depends on audit, residency, and policy requirements |
| Long-term agility | Strong for standardized growth | Strong for specialized operating models | Agility is highest when architecture and governance are aligned |
What architecture choices matter most for global scale?
Global scale is rarely limited by raw compute alone. It is more often constrained by data model design, integration patterns, role governance, and deployment consistency. API-first architecture is especially important in subscription businesses because CRM, CPQ, payment gateways, product telemetry, support systems, and data platforms all influence billing and revenue outcomes. ERP should not become an isolated finance island. It should act as a governed transaction and reporting backbone within a broader enterprise architecture.
When deployment control is relevant, technologies such as Kubernetes and Docker can support portability, environment consistency, and operational resilience in dedicated cloud, private cloud, or hybrid cloud models. Data services such as PostgreSQL and Redis may also be relevant where performance, extensibility, and workload isolation matter. These technologies are not selection criteria by themselves, but they become important when enterprises need predictable scaling, controlled release management, or a managed cloud services partner to operate the platform with clear accountability.
How can organizations reduce vendor lock-in without slowing modernization?
Vendor lock-in is best managed through architecture and commercial design, not by avoiding modernization. The practical objective is to preserve negotiating leverage, data portability, and process flexibility while still benefiting from cloud ERP capabilities. Enterprises should evaluate exportability of financial and operational data, openness of APIs, extensibility boundaries, integration ownership, and the effort required to replace adjacent systems over time. A platform that is easy to buy but difficult to evolve can become more expensive than a more deliberate initial choice.

Common mistakes that increase ERP risk
- Choosing based on brand familiarity instead of subscription-specific process fit.
- Treating revenue recognition as a finance-only requirement rather than a cross-functional operating design issue.
- Underestimating integration strategy between CRM, billing, payments, product systems, and ERP.
- Allowing uncontrolled customization that raises upgrade cost and weakens governance.
- Ignoring cloud deployment model implications for security, compliance, and operational resilience.
- Failing to define migration strategy, data ownership, and cutover accountability early in the program.
What decision framework should executives use?
A practical executive decision framework uses five weighted lenses. First, financial control: can the platform support accurate recognition, auditability, and close efficiency? Second, operating flexibility: can the business evolve pricing, packaging, and regional models without constant rework? Third, architecture fit: does the ERP align with cloud deployment preferences, integration strategy, and security model? Fourth, economic sustainability: is the TCO acceptable under expected growth, including licensing, support, and change costs? Fifth, delivery confidence: does the vendor and partner model provide the right balance of accountability, ecosystem depth, and managed services capability?
This framework helps avoid false trade-offs. For example, a highly standardized SaaS ERP may be the right answer for a company seeking rapid global harmonization. A dedicated cloud or private cloud model may be better where compliance, performance isolation, or specialized workflows are strategic. A white-label ERP approach may be strongest for channel-led businesses building repeatable offerings. The best decision is the one that supports the target operating model with manageable risk, not the one with the longest feature list.
